FRIENDLY VILLAGE NURSING AND REHAB CENTER

RHINELANDER, WI · Medicare-certified · 100 beds

In good standing
For-profitChain member
4 of 5 overall

4-star nursing home overall. It has a 3-star health inspection rating, 4-star staffing, and 5-star quality measures, with no fines in the last 24 months; reported nurse staffing is 3.50 hours per resident per day, below the federal benchmark of 4.1.

What the inspectors found

The home failed to make sure food was safely sourced, stored, prepared, and served according to professional standards. Cited February 2025 — widespread issue, potential for harm.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 812 — 42 CFR §483.60(i) — S/S: F

The home failed to submit complete and accurate staffing information based on verifiable records. Cited February 2025 — widespread issue, potential for harm.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 851 — 42 CFR §483.70 — S/S: F

The home failed to notify the resident and family in time before a transfer or discharge, including their right to appeal. Cited February 2025 — limited pattern, potential for harm.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 623 — 42 CFR §483.15 — S/S: E

The nursing home failed to provide and carry out an infection prevention and control program to help keep residents from getting or spreading infections. Cited January 2024 — limited pattern, potential for harm.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 880 — 42 CFR §483.80(a) — S/S: E

The nursing home failed to make sure each resident got an accurate assessment of their needs and condition. Cited February 2025 — isolated incident, potential for harm.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 641 — 42 CFR §483.20(g) — S/S: D
